Common Misconceptions About Carpet Cleaning

Some of the most common misconceptions can turn homeowners away from investing in carpets or give them unrealistic expectations. Let us discuss some common myths and misconceptions about carpet cleaning and debunk them.

  • Cleaning a Carpet Only After They Appear Dirty

This is one of the worst practices that can significantly reduce a carpet’s life. Even if your carpet appears clean to the average eye, it can be home to millions of dirt particles, dust mites, and pollutants. These microscopic particles can cause allergic reactions and respiratory issues, making your carpet appear dull and leaving a musty smell.

  • Carpets are A Major Source of All Allergens in Your Home

Although we have heard that carpets can trap unusually high amounts of allergens, they are not the source. The same allergens that float in your indoor air settle on your carpets.   • Steam Cleaning Can Damage Your Carpet Fibers

Most homeowners believe that hiring a steam carpet cleaning company in Gainesville means death for their carpets. However, nothing could be further from the truth as steam carpet cleaning helps deep clean the carpet, and it eradicates any dirt or dust stuck deep within the fibers of your rug. This misconception started as a result of fear that a carpet’s synthetic material would shrink due to the steam cleaner. 

A steam cleaner is in no way harmful to a carpet and its fibers, and it can disinfect your carpet to an extent while also breathing fresh, renewed life into your worn-down rugs.

  • Household Cleaning Solutions are as Good as Professional Products

The caveat of relying on DIY carpet cleaning hacks is that they often employ the use of a household cleaning solution like bleach, vinegar, paint thinner, and even club soda. Although you may get rid of the stains by using these products, you also risk damaging your carpet fibers. Corrosive solutions like bleach can harm your hardwood floors and your pets and children, who spend a lot of time on the carpets. 

Vinegar is one of the most common household cleaners; however, it cannot remove any unwanted smells from the carpet, even if it removes any stains. Similarly, using paint thinner on dropped paint can cause more harm than fixing your carpets. Club soda is also a standard DIY cleaning solution, albeit an ineffective one.
